Output 6a59b66252ecdc9034b77f79a635d934773cd7a95362d56e100eec335507ded2:0

value
434485
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9e9ad8833d4319dd251533964239f38f536de13 OP_EQUAL
address
3HBS4BhzQSULt231T61fm4fNfgwEH5LYuS
transaction
6a59b66252ecdc9034b77f79a635d934773cd7a95362d56e100eec335507ded2
spent
true